Fall in love with Joeboy’s New Afrobeats Singles, “Adenuga” and “Concerning”

Joeboy (@joeboyofficial) is an Afrobeats superstar from Lagos, Nigeria. Not too long ago, he returned with two wholehearted tracks, “Adenuga” featuring Qing Madi and “Concerning,” that showcase two contrasting sides to the artist’s character. From the inception of his career, Joeboy has cemented himself as the quintessential lover-boy, and these new songs only serve to reinforce this persona while delving deeper into the complexities of love and relationships.

“Adenuga” sees Joeboy teaming up with budding sensation Qing Madi to deliver a heartfelt anthem celebrating the enduring power of love. In a landscape frequently dominated by toxic portrayals of romance, Joeboy offers a refreshing perspective, championing the ideals of fairy tale love and grand gestures.

Discussing the single, Joeboy stated, “Love is beautiful but can be annoying when it’s unrequited. In the moment, it’s annoying and somewhat painful but that shouldn’t stop you from putting yourself out there again and again. If anything, it prepares you for when you find the one.”

Speaking about collaborating with Qing Madi, Joeboy expressed his admiration, stating, “Madi is so talented. I’ve been a fan since she did a cover of my song ‘Body & Soul’ last year. We have been looking for the perfect song to collaborate on and when she heard ‘Give You The World,’ she fell in love with it and delivered a sick verse.”

On the flip side, the second single “Concerning” delves into the darker aspects of love, harnessing an uptempo, spaced-out groove and shedding light on the confusion and pain that often accompany unrequited affection. Through introspective lyrics and soul-stirring melodies, Joeboy takes listeners on a journey through the tumultuous yet rewarding waters of love and relationships, capturing the raw emotions that come with navigating matters of the heart.

“Adenuga” and “Concerning” follow the success of Joeboy’s previously released single “Osadebe,” which has garnered over 9.4 million streams since its release.

Exploring themes of self-reflection and positive affirmations, “Osadebe” is a cultural anthem that dominated the music scene in the southeast and south-south regions of Nigeria in the early 2000s. Through his lyrics: “I no dey cross my lane, I’m living like Osadebe, Osondi Owendi,” Joeboy asserts his individuality, expressing a determination to chart his course in the music industry without succumbing to unnecessary comparisons and pressures.

Encapsulating the artistic sensibilities of his sound, the K-Dreamz produced “Osadebe” is a testament to Joeboy’s versatility and evolution as an artist, offering a glimpse into the musical journey he is embarking on. The single sets the stage for a series of releases culminating in a much-anticipated EP towards the end of the year.

Joeboy’s journey to stardom began in 2017 when he caught the attention of emPawa Africa founder Mr Eazi, with a cover of Ed Sheeran’s “Shape Of You.” Since gaining recognition following the release of his hit single “Baby,” which was followed up with consecutive hit singles ‘Beginning’ and ‘Don’t Call Me Back’ feat. Mayorkun, Joeboy has risen in status and level to become one of Africa’s leading talents and global exports, amassing over 2 billion streams and earning the title of the 2nd African artist to surpass 100 million streams on Boomplay.

Entering this exciting new chapter and navigating the industry on his own terms, through “Adenuga” and “Concerning,” Joeboy reaffirms his status as one of Nigeria’s finest musical talents.
